Some questions that arise regarding my new book on Trump & Antichrist follow. |
Why is the first chapter about Sigmund Freud? Freud underwent an amazing encounter with the same fresco that I did on visiting the Orvieto Cathedral in 1897. In fact, he was so taken by it that he returned two more times to study it. An entire book, excellently researched and beautifully written, is devoted to the impact that fresco had on Freud. It is called Freud’s Trip to Orvieto. The author, Nicholas Fox Weber,
is an art historian. |
|
I
include that chapter right up front in my book because it demonstrates that art goes much deeper than theology, insofar as Freud, a declared atheist, nevertheless found himself smitten by the archetype of the Antichrist along with the other two frescos in the same chapel, one on Hell and another on “The Resurrection of the Flesh.” |
As
a rule, it is the evangelicals and fundamentalists who have opined on “the Antichrist” in recent times, but my book does the opposite: I take the Antichrist archetype and apply it to those whose politics and values are oriented to the common good which includes truth, justice and the building of community. If Freud was vulnerable to a religious archetype of significance, other leftward thinking persons can surely join the cause and a new consensus on the left can
emerge.

What do you mean when you say the opposite of evil is not the good but the Sacred? This was one of the findings I came to in writing my major study on Evil, Sins of the Spirit, Blessings of the Flesh: Transforming Evil in Soul and Society. This means that
we cannot have |
|
a conversation on evil until we have a conversation on the Sacred. If we are out of touch with the Sacred, we are necessarily out of touch with how to deal with evil; we see only its effects, we don’t get to its essence and we don’t deal with it effectively therefore. |
